Colombia is the world’s greatest producer of cocaine and was the source of nearly 90% of the cocaine seized and tested in U.S. labs in 2019, according to the U.S. Department of State.
The drug cartels next door in Mexico, until very recently, kept fentanyl labs running 24-7 to meet the demand in the U.S.
